WebTreatment. Scalp ringworm is a dermatophyte (fungal) infection of the scalp. Symptoms of tinea capitis include a dry patch of scale, a patch of hair loss, or both on the scalp. Doctors base the diagnosis on an examination of the scalp and samples taken from the scalp. Treatment includes antifungal drugs taken by mouth for all people and, for ...

WebJan 22, 2024 · Your doctor will likely be able to diagnose ringworm of the scalp by looking at the affected skin and asking certain questions. To confirm the diagnosis, your doctor may take a sample of hair or skin to be tested in a lab. Testing a sample of hair or skin can show if a fungus is present. WebApr 14, 2024 · Assuming these worms were found inside our reader’s home, the most typical thin, black worms people found in homes are either horsehair worms or earthworms. Horsehair worms are parasites that infect insects and crustaceans, but not humans. They are marine worms, but can survive on land.
